While many hotels have been trying to up their sustainability game over the past few years, the majority of these massive travel hubs still leave a large ecological footprint. For the earth-conscious traveler, staying at hotels often contradict their eco-friendly principals. Enter Airbnb. The far-reaching company offers sustainable rentals for guests who are mindful of the environment, and also want an authentic experience. Endless, beautiful accommodations give travelers countless options to select from, ranging from ocean-front luxe homes to dreamy tropical tree houses. Check out these five dreamy eco-friendly homes you can rent on Airbnb.
Secluded Intown Treehouse

Named Airbnb's #1 "most wished for listing worldwide" in 2016 and 2017, this dreamy treehouse in Atlanta will leave you feeling inspired, rested, and one with nature. The Secluded Intown Treehouse has three beautiful rooms - each huddled in the trees - and are connected by a rope bridge. The sitting room is chock full of antique artifacts and comfy couches, while a balcony overlooks the sea of trees. The linens in the bedroom are 100% long-staple Egyptian cotton, pure linen, and are chemical and synthetic free. Once you peel yourself off of the world’s comfiest bed, head to the hammock room where you will find a deck wrapped around a 165-year-old Southern shortleaf pine - perfect for meditating, reading, and bird-watching.
Off-Grid itHouse

Located in the secluded valley of Pioneertown in the expansive California high desert, the Off-Grid itHouse combines architectural intelligence with green design. It is 100% off-grid (purposefully no internet or TV) -- energy and hot water are powered by solar panels. The itHouse is the prototype of 10 other IT homes, all of which promote green principals supporting the use of renewable resources. They focus on creating the least amount of disturbance to the surrounding landscape, leaving a smaller footprint, and living simply and minimally.
Unique Cobb Cottage

The Unique Cobb Cottage on Mayne Island is a hand-sculpted cozy abode made of local, sustainable, naturally sourced materials. Just a ferry ride away off of the coast of British Columbia, the cottage's hosts offer free pick up and drop off so your car can remain on the mainland. (A community bus is also available for easy transportation.) Enjoy your time on the island by exploring the beautiful acreage of rolling pastures, gardens, and grazing sheep.
Hideout Bali: Eco Bamboo Home

Experience everything nature has to offer at Hideout Bali, an eco-bamboo home nestled in the mountains of Gunung Agung volcano near Selat. This two-story getaway is a genuine Bali experience. Wake to the sound of wildlife, savor local seasonal fruits, and cool down in the river that runs alongside the home. Internet access is weak to unavailable, so be ready to disconnect from day-to-day stresses and bask in Balinese beauty.
Sustainable Catskills A-Frame

This two bedroom Sustainable Catskills A-Frame in the town of Kerhonkson is off the grid and solar powered. Perfect for a weekend escape, the home offers modern amenities including a chef's kitchen, soaking tubs, and an open floor plan great for entertaining. Outside, you will find a fire pit along with a bbq grill, picnic table, and screened-in gazebo. Literally planted in the middle of the woods, this upstate A-frame is built on two acres, has a spring fed pond and towering trees for as far as the eye can see.
